Detailed Explanation

The name Siobhan is the Irish form of the name Joan or Johanna, and it carries a rich cultural heritage. In practice, in Irish, it means "God is gracious," and it has been a popular name in Ireland for centuries. Even so, its spelling and pronunciation can be challenging for those outside of Irish culture, which is precisely why it often appears in crossword puzzles. Scientific or Theoretical Perspective

From a linguistic perspective, the name Siobhan is an excellent example of how language and culture intersect. Still, the name's spelling reflects its Irish Gaelic roots, while its pronunciation is influenced by the phonetic rules of the Irish language. This disconnect between spelling and pronunciation is a common feature in many languages, particularly those with deep historical roots like Irish.

FAQs

Q: Why does the name Siobhan appear in crossword puzzles? A: The name Siobhan is often used in crossword puzzles because of its unique spelling and pronunciation, which can make for interesting and challenging clues.

Q: How do I pronounce the name Siobhan? A: The name Siobhan is pronounced "shi-VAWN" or "shi-VOHN," depending on the regional dialect.

Q: What does the name Siobhan mean? A: The name Siobhan is of Irish origin and means "God is gracious."

Q: Are there other names like Siobhan that appear in crossword puzzles? A: Yes, other Irish names like Niamh, Caoimhe, and Aisling are also commonly used in crossword puzzles for similar reasons.
